Jekyll Island Golf Club - Indian Mound Course
About
Jekyll Island Golf Club is Georgia's largest public golf facility, offering three 18-hole courses and a nine-hole course. Two of the 18-hole courses, Pine Lakes and Indian Mound, have similar characteristics since they sit side by side. Both are younger than the Oleander, which is considered the toughest of the three and served as host to the Georgia Open for four years. The Indian Mound Course is the shortest of the three at just under 6,500 yards from the back tees but that is not to say you won't run into a fair amount of challenges. The layout features lengthy par 5s that you wouldn't expect given the yardage, and the par 4s offer scoring opportunities for those who take advantage of the short shots into the green. The Indian Mound Course's main challenges are the undulating greens and abundance of sand.
| Tee | Par | Length | Rating | Slope |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Crane/Blue | 72 | 6469 yards | 71.1 | 129 |
| Rockefeller/White (W) | 72 | 6221 yards | 69.9 | 127 |
| Rockefeller/White | 72 | 6221 yards | 76.0 | 134 |
| Gould/Gold | 72 | 5672 yards | 67.3 | 121 |
| Gould/Gold (W) | 72 | 5672 yards | 72.7 | 127 |
| Morgan/Purple | 72 | 5185 yards | 65.2 | 115 |
| Morgan/Purple (W) | 72 | 5185 yards | 69.9 | 119 |
| Maurice/Red | 72 | 4964 yards | 64.2 | 112 |
| Maurice/Red (W) | 72 | 4964 yards | 68.7 | 117 |
